You Are That Which You Seek (the ultimate book for modern men – and women)

Episode in Josh's Brew
I recently came into contact with the most beautiful, sacred soul while in Antarctica. I’m filming there for 3 months. She told me she had read one of the books I return to often: The Way of the Superior Man by David Deida. Firstly, what struck me, was the fact that she was open and curious about this book seemingly directed at “men.” Second, was the coming to terms with society clearly living in this age where the gender polarities are being flipped upside down on their heads. The feminine is taking on the masculine role in society and we are left with men who are more disembodied than ever. Divine woman are divine mirrors. They are either going to magnify your divine masculine essence or they are going to mirror your lack of direction. In the case of the latter, this is where extreme cases of codependency and sometimes even obsessive or violent behaviours show up. I do not think we necessarily need more awareness around “gender based”violence in the typical way we see it. I just don’t think changing your Instagram profile picture a certain colour will do much to alter the oppressors behaviour (in this case, a man); what we need is grass-root, spiritual level of change in society. To me this looks and feels like a returning home. To the stars. To our primordial, ancient, purpose-driven selves. If we to are really make change within the men of today we need more men who are purpose-driven, star-aligned and integrated. Which brings me to the essence of the book in one sentence: as a man, your mission & purpose is the most important thing in your life. I was raised on the false predication from society that as a man what I needed most was validation — especially in the form of sex. This took on the shape that it did for most men my age: pornography. Porn taught us as males there is only one goal when it comes to relating to the feminine: sex. The word that springs to mind is domination. Porn is mostly built on lack of love — it is an act of the male dominating the woman in order to climax. So, we are in a time where most men are conditioned towards this end goal of climax instead of connection and love. This is why ancient text write about waiting for marriage before sex — there has to be strong connection first before entering the femine. You are not just entering your woman superficially: you are entering the spirit of each other, and if that spirit is not pure you are going to take on all that residue of impurity, and overtime, that is going to manifest as disease and eventually hatred.f My feelings are, if we truly want change, we need integration. We need integration of masculine and feminine into each soul. We need to be reading books that take us outside our usual SOP’s and inside the celestial everylasting understanding of our true starseeded origins which goes beyond gender — it’s pure love seeing itself through the incarnated causal body. Your Mission is Your Priority I’ve always told myself this lie: that when I get the perfect woman, I will be happy. My biggest shadow was subconsciously believing this lie. It showed up in my last relationship: it was the deepest connection to another human I had ever felt — it was so deep it crushed me. It came as a Karmic Relationship to teach me a vital lesson which this profound book on truth teaches: your purpose, as a man, must come before your woman. “Your mission is your priority. Unless you know your mission and have aligned your life to it, your core will feel empty. Your presence in the world will be weakened, as will your presence with your intimate partner. Have you ever seen that video of the late Steve Irwin speaking to a reporter about money? It’s one of my favourite videos in the world. The way his wife Terri looks at him is the essence of this book: she is looking at him with pure love not because he is obsessed with her, but because he is obsessed with his mission. The paradox here is having a clear mission in life actually deepens your love for the feminine in all forms — to your woman, Gaia, chaos, uncertainty, the ocean….the list goes on. You begin to spend more time going back to where you came from: the Motherly Source. “There is no essential difference between entering your woman’s feminine heart and entering fully into the world. Both forms of intercourse, sexual and worldly, require sensitivity, spontaneity, and a strong connection to deep truth in order to penetrate chaos and closure in a way that love prevails.” You may think or your woman may think she wants to be the centre of your world, but she does not. In truth, she desires your truth: which is your mission. There is nothing more attractive than a man living his Truth (Steve Urwin video for context). You Are That Which You Seek I’ve been working with a mentor for the past few months. The work has changed me on the cellular level. I do not recognize the person I was 3 months ago. Working in combination with the sacred San Pedro plant, Gene Keys + Human Design and various somatic techniques, I’ve rewired old, ancient ancestral beliefs I’ve carried into this lifetime. The biggest one being codependency. “You are that which you seek, but you have left your own deepness and are looking elsewhere. The stress of not finding it creates its own need to be released. And so the cycle continues. You are chasing your own tail, and much of the time that tail looks suspiciously like a woman. But you need not stop chasing. Instead, chase. Allow yourself to feel how badly you want her. Feel how deep is the itch you want scratched. Feel the need that drives you, for most of your adult life, to yearn for a woman, in flesh or in fantasy. And discover what it is you really want…your need is far deeper than any woman can provide. So what is it? Your ultimate desire is for the union of consciousness with its own luminosity, wherein all appearance is recognized as your deep, blissful nature, and there is only One. Your desire for union with a woman is a stepped-down version of this ultimate spiritual need.” There is a lot to unpack here but the big two lessons are: 1) if you don’t realise your true, divine self you will project neediness and codependency onto your partner and even close family members and 2) there is noting wrong with craving the feminine — in fact, it’s he most masculine thing you can feel. But we are conditioned as men to turn that craving into a form of release which often looks like ejaculation. What the ancients write about in various forms is that your sexual energy is powerful. So how you show up when you feel that desire for another is how you transform that energy. I can attest myself, since giving up porn a few years ago, things, at least I feel, un-coincidentally changed. What About the Next “Vision”? We’ve spoken about this need for mission, purpose and vision as men. But what if you don’t have one? Deida explains…. “There is no way to rush this process. You may need to get an intermediary job to hold you over until the next layer of purpose makes itself clear. Or, perhaps you have enough money to simply wait. But in any case, it is important to open yourself to a vision of what is next. You stay open to a vision of your deeper purpose by not filling your time with distractions. Don’t watch TV or play computer games. Don’t go out drinking beer with your friends every night or start dating a bunch of women. Simply wait. You may wish to go on a retreat in a remote area and be by yourself. Whatever it is you decide to do, consciously keep yourself open and available to receiving a vision of what is next. It will come.” And again, we have to appreciate the humor of the Gods. Because when a vision comes, at least I’ve felt, it often comes but it isn’t necessarily detailed. This is the place I live in currently, my vision is strong, but its open and mysterious: “When it comes, it usually won’t be a detailed vision. You will probably have a sense of what direction to move in, but the practical steps might not make themselves clear. When the impulse begins to arise, act on it. Don’t wait for the details. Learn by trial and error what it is you are to do.” Going Back to Source In Human Design, I am what you call a Hermit-Opportunist. I could never quite figure out why my entire life I craved this paradoxically juxtaposed way of life: on the one hand if you are close to me you will see me as very socially driven, quite extroverty to say the least…but on the other hand, if you also know me well, you will know I need space alone to recharge. My alone time is where I am most creative and is where I connect to Source. Until Human Design put language to this I always thought I kind of had a bit of a problem — as if I didn’t quite know who I am. “Whatever the specifics of a man’s purpose, he must always refresh the transcendental element of his life through regular meditation and retreat. A man should never get lost in the details of his life and forget that, ultimately and in truth, life amounts to nothing other than what is the deepest truth of this present moment. Tasks don’t get a man anywhere more conscious or free than he is capable of being in this present moment.” It’s really important for me to refresh my connection with Source through regular mediation, reading, retreats even diet. When I eat low vibrational foods I feel disconnected. When I eat higher vibrational foods from these sacred southern African lands that have been cared for by the custodians I feel so connected and grounded. ultimately, this is not a book directed at men: it’s directed at humanity. If we all took time to integrate our masculine and feminine parts we will have more love and understanding for the parts of ourselves and humanity that is facing the biggest struggle now: which is the feminine. The mother, the sacred divine Earth, is the source of life — and yet we treat her conditionally. “Like the ocean, the native state of the feminine is to flow with great power and no single direction…the feminine energy itself is undirected but immense, like the wind and deep currents of the ocean, ever changing, beautiful, destructive, and the source of life.” So it’s simple: spending more time in Nature is akin to spending more time with the feminine. Your connection to this native feminine state of both chaos and creation will determine your connection to the feminine in flesh. Get full access to Josh Snyman at joshsnyman.substack.com/subscribe

Regenerative Farming, Rebirth & Hunting for Conservation in South Africa’s Eastern Cape

Episode in Josh's Brew
Transcript Summary 👇 In about two weeks, I’m embarking on something I’ve wanted to do for a very long time: hunt my own wild animal. I reached out to a gent I’ve gotten to know over the last few months—Dylan Love from PH Journals. He runs the number one hunting podcast in Africa. Hunting has always been a fascinating subject for me because, like many others, I feel disconnected from it. I don’t know the intricacies of the industry or how important hunting actually is for conservation. I even called up my good friend, Farmer Angus, for advice. He offered to take me out on his range for some practice shooting—which I’ll definitely share more about soon. If you want to see some behind-the-scenes footage, you can follow me on Instagram @josh_snyman Reverence in Hunting The word that keeps coming through for me is reverence. I believe hunting is a sacred act. There’s a deep level of respect required when you take the life of a wild animal. To me, there’s even a feminine energy in that act—a nurturing, cyclical energy that connects life, death, and rebirth. Of course, there are people who exploit the system, but that’s true everywhere. The light always shines through when people approach things with respect. And Dylan, I feel, is bringing a lot of light into the hunting space. Facing Death This journey feels wild and strange. Life has stripped me bare. I know I’m not unique in this—many people experience it—but it’s a necessary process. It entails death. The death of the old self. The painful kind of death that forces transformation. And that’s really what hunting is: developing a relationship with the inevitable. With death. We live in a culture that avoids death at all costs. We change ourselves, shape our appearances, chase endless distractions—all in an attempt to escape the one true inevitability. But what if death isn’t something to fear? The ancients—Maya, Toltec, and others—saw death as a sacred act, a celebration. A transformation into another epoch, another life. So what if death isn’t death at all? What if death is just rebirth? That’s how I want to approach hunting. With reverence. With curiosity. With humility. Africa, Mama Africa There’s a lot happening in the world right now. But I can’t help but feel that here, in South Africa, we need to stop looking outside for the solutions. We need to begin right here, on this land. Recently, I released a video on the destructive mining practices happening on South Africa’s West Coast. The response was overwhelming. Hundreds of comments, so many people voicing their care. It reminded me that people do give a shit. But the truth is, it starts small. It starts local. I was walking on Signal Hill not long ago and, from a distance, it looked like paradise. Sunset. Silhouettes. People enjoying themselves. But up close? Rubbish everywhere. Plastic tossed all over the sacred hillside. That’s the paradox of our time. From far away—beauty. Up close—disconnection. We keep focusing on outside problems, but the real work is right here. On Mama Africa’s soil. She is birthing a new consciousness. And we need to respect her, love her, and realize she loves us unconditionally. When we honor her, the vibration of this land changes. The food changes. The animals. The communities. Everything. Reconnection Nature doesn’t care how we feel about death. She will keep cycling through life, death, and rebirth regardless. The real respect comes when we stop buying lifeless, plastic-wrapped meat from chain stores and instead build relationships with butchers, farmers, and rural communities. That’s where reconnection begins. Our food system is broken because we’ve disconnected from the custodians of the land. Farmers receive almost nothing for their hard work, while corporations and executives reap the profits. No wonder our food has fewer minerals, fewer nutrients. The topsoil is being stripped of life. This is why it all begins with the farmer. With the hunter. With the custodians of the land. If we respect them, if we honor their work, that respect ripples outward to the people. Imagine if even politicians re-wilded themselves. If they walked barefoot on the land, spoke to the people, understood the problems at a granular level instead of from spreadsheets. What decisions might they make then? This is why I’m approaching hunting not just as an act of taking life, but as an act of reverence, of reconnection. A chance to remember that death is not the end. It’s the beginning.It’s rebirth. Get full access to Josh Snyman at joshsnyman.substack.com/subscribe

Daniel Maté on co-authoring THE MYTH OF NORMAL with his father: Dr Gabor Maté

Episode in Josh's Brew
Please enjoy this beautiful (and vulnerable) conversation with Mr Daniel Maté who recently co-authored The Myth of Normal: Trauma, Illness & Healing in a Toxic Culture DANIEL MATÉ is a composer, lyricist, and playwright for musical theatre based in BC and New York. He has been active since 2007, when he graduated from New York University’s Tisch School of the Arts with an M.F.A. in Musical Theatre Writing. He also holds a B.A. in Psychology and Philosophy from McGill. Daniel received the prestigious Edward Kleban Prize for Most Promising Lyricist in American Musical Theatre, a Jonathan Larson Foundation Grant, and the ASCAP Foundation’s Cole Porter Award for Excellence in Music and Lyrics (for his song cycle The Longing and the Short of It.) He has presented his work at the historic Kennedy Center in Washington, DC and New York’s Lincoln Center, and was an invited participant in the inaugural Johnny Mercer Writers Colony.
